Pumping from Disi water pipeline resumes after planned outage
Pumping from the Disi water pipeline to Amman and Zarqa resumed Thursday after a 4-day suspension for planned maintenance which started on Sunday.
Secretary-General of the Water Authority of Jordan Ahmad Olimat indicated that pumping to areas in Amman and Zarqa has now resumed as normal and will follow the usual weekly schedule.
He thanked citizens for their understanding and cooperation with authorities during the pumping suspension.
